Powerful Dua for Broken Relationship Healing

One of the most recommended Quranic Dua for Broken Relationship to Heal Fast
is:

“Rabbi inni lima anzalta ilayya min khairin faqir.”

Meaning

“My Lord, indeed I am in need of whatever good You send down to me.”

This beautiful dua was recited by Prophet Musa (AS) when he needed Allah’s help and guidance.

Dua to Bring Hearts Together

Another powerful Islamic Dua for Broken Relationship to Heal Fast
is:

“Allahumma allif baina qulubina.”

Meaning

“O Allah, unite our hearts.”

This dua asks Allah to remove conflict and create understanding between people.

Dua for Patience During Relationship Problems

Relationship difficulties often create stress and sadness. During such times, recite:

“Hasbunallahu wa ni’mal wakeel.”

Meaning

“Allah is sufficient for us, and He is the best disposer of affairs.”

This dua reminds believers to trust Allah and place their worries in His hands.

Best Time to Make Dua for Broken Relationship to Heal Fast

Some times are especially blessed for making dua.

During Tahajjud

The last third of the night is one of the most powerful times for prayer.

After Obligatory Salah

Spend a few moments making sincere dua after every prayer.

On Fridays

Friday contains a special hour when duas are accepted.

While Fasting

The prayer of a fasting person has a special status before Allah.

Avoid Haram Methods

Some people become desperate when a relationship breaks.

Islam strictly forbids:

Black Magic

Magic is prohibited in Islam.

Love Spells

Spells and rituals are not halal.

Fake Spiritual Services

Avoid people who promise guaranteed results.

Manipulation

Respect the feelings and choices of others.

The halal path is through dua, patience, and sincere effort.
